Especificações
| Atributo | Valor |
| Package | Tube |
| ProductStatus | Active |
| Applications | Voltage Feedback |
| NumberofCircuits | 2 |
| -3dbBandwidth | 130 MHz |
| SlewRate | 450V/µs |
| Current-Supply | 14 mA |
| Current-Output/Channel | 50 mA |
| Voltage-SupplySingle/Dual(±) | 5V ~ 36V, ±2.5V ~ 18V |
| MountingType | Surface Mount |
| Package/Case | 8-SOIC (0.154, 3.90mm Width) |

Description
The AD828ARZ features a low input offset voltage and a high slew rate, making it suitable for precision applications. It operates on a single or dual power supply, offering flexibility in various circuit designs. The op-amp has a low power consumption, which is advantageous for battery-powered devices or applications where energy efficiency is crucial.
Its inputs and outputs are protected against overload, and it maintains stability across a wide range of loads. This operational amplifier is also known for its low distortion and noise, ensuring high-quality signal amplification. Overall, the AD828ARZ is a versatile component suitable for a range of high-speed and high-precision applications.
